Bill Summary
Tax Administration Reform Act of 2002 - Title I: Fairness in Tax Collection Procedures - (Sec. 101) Amends the Internal Revenue Code to stipulate that the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) may enter into installment agreements with taxpayers that do not provide for full payment of liabilities. Requires the IRS to review partial payment installment agreements at least every two years.(Sec. 102) Extends from nine months to two years the period in...
